画像ファイルを使用して大きな画像をアップロードしようとすると、サーバーへのPOSTに含まれません。POSTリクエストでファイルがサーバーに送信されることを確認するためのアイデアはありますか?
質問する
136 次
2 に答える
1
サーバーが何であるかを言う必要があります。それが制限を指定するものだからです。一般的に、POSTリクエストには制限が定義されていませんが、ファイル以外のPOSTエントリの場合、一部のブラウザ では制限が設定されており、場合によっては約2MBになります。
サーバーの種類を教えてください。制限を変更する方法を教えてくれます(サーバーがある程度制御できると仮定します)。また、転送する予定のファイルサイズをお知らせください。
于 2012-07-17T19:06:31.293 に答える
0
コメントで言ったように、それはブラウザとは何の関係もありません、それはあなたのサーバーの設定と関係があります。
それはドキュメントにあります:https ://docs.djangoproject.com/en/dev/topics/http/file-uploads/?from = olddocs
アップロードハンドラの動作の変更
3つの設定がDjangoのファイルアップロード動作を制御します。
FILE_UPLOAD_MAX_MEMORY_SIZE
メモリにアップロードされるファイルの最大サイズ(バイト単位)。FILE_UPLOAD_MAX_MEMORY_SIZEより大きいファイルは、ディスクにストリーミングされます。
Defaults to 2.5 megabytes.
于 2012-07-17T19:11:14.507 に答える